"Disk degeneration L5-S1" refers to a condition where the cushion-like disk between the fifth lumbar vertebra and the first sacral vertebra, located in the lower back, is wearing down or deteriorating. This can lead to a decrease in the disk's ability to act as a shock absorber in the spine, potentially causing discomfort or pain. It's a common part of aging and doesn't always cause symptoms.
